This exhibit is an ECC86 double triode. It is very special high frequency double triode. At a time when AF power transistors were replacing valves but no VHF transistors were available the ECC86 was designed to operate directly from vehicle battery supplies for car radio applications alongside transistors.
One half of the valve. The depression in the anode is so the working face can be close to the grid but with lower capacitance than if the whole anode was that close.
The two sections are separated by a screen.
The thin glass tube envelope is 20 mm in diameter and, excluding the B9A base pins, is 49 mm tall.
Reference: Data-sheet Type ECC86 was first introduced in 1959. See also 1959 adverts.
